Analysis

The most recent figure for ippu — emissions (co2) — fao tier 1 in Poland is 12,900 kt, measured in 2023.

That represents a change of down 9.8% on the previous year and up 0.8% over ten years.

Over the whole period, ippu — emissions (co2) — fao tier 1 in Poland peaked at 19,400 kt in 1977 and was at its lowest, 8,710 kt, in 2002.

That places Poland 34th out of 218 countries with data for 2023, putting it in the top quarter.

The long-run direction has been consistently falling across the 63 years of available data.

Averages by decade

DecadeAverage LowestHighest Years
1960s 11,984 kt 9,090 kt 14,800 kt 9
1970s 17,060 kt 14,200 kt 19,400 kt 10
1980s 15,170 kt 14,000 kt 18,200 kt 10
1990s 10,651 kt 9,330 kt 12,300 kt 10
2000s 11,244 kt 8,710 kt 14,000 kt 10
2010s 13,760 kt 12,100 kt 15,100 kt 10
2020s 14,250 kt 12,900 kt 15,000 kt 4

The FAOSTAT domain on Emissions Totals summarizes the greenhouse gas (GHG) emissions disseminated in the FAOSTAT Climate Change domains of emissions from agrifood systems. Data are computed following the Tier 1 methods of the Intergovernmental Panel on Climate Change (IPCC) Guidelines for National greenhouse gas (GHG) Inventories (IPCC, 1996; 1997; 2000; 2002; 2006; 2014). Emissions from other economic sectors as defined by the IPCC are also disseminated in the domain for completeness.
